Bulls without skipper Kovacs

21 February 2011 17:00
Hereford will be without suspended skipper Janos Kovacs when they come up against Northampton at Edgar Street. The centre-back was shown a second yellow card for bringing down Calvin Zola nine minutes into the second half of Saturday`s goalless draw against Burton and now serves a one-match ban. Kovacs is likely to be replaced by like-for-like replacement Michael Townsend, who returned to the bench at the weekend having served a one-match suspension of his own. Otherwise, manager Jamie Pitman is likely to keep changes, if any, to a minimum having named the same XI on Saturday as the one which saw off Cheltenham 3-0. Victory over the Cobblers, who have drawn their previous four matches, could put Hereford eight points clear of the drop zone after their point against Burton provided them with a bit more breathing space at the bottom. Pitman said: "If we win the Northampton game we get four points from these two games and that`s a good return, what we have to do is make sure we try to do that."
